Default C5 Corvette

I have a 2000 Corvette, when I start the car Service Vehicle Soon appears, I was just at the deal they checked for codes nothing. they cleared but as soon I turn off the car and turn it back on it shows up again any ideas what can be.

Has your battery died/been replaced recently? This happened to me on Easter when my battery was dead and needed to be jump started. You can check for codes yourself and make sure there are not codes. The video below shows how to do so, if they code is old and been addressed it will have an H after it. If it is current and not been addressed it will have a C after it.
